How does this play?
Here's how to play.
First off, vote for who you think will win to earn points.
Five points if the person wins, one point if the person loses.
Then you can buy from the "shop". There are six items to buy, each and every one is extremely useful in combat.
To start a challenge, you have to PM me and request to fight. If somebody is deemed worthy, the fight will start. When it does, you will be notified.
For a fight, everybody is equally matched unless you use a stat modifier item.
Once the fight starts, nobody can join in. That's it.
Losing takes away one point if you can afford it. Winning gives five points.
You have to roll 1 through 6 for everything that happens.
Before we get into what rolling affects, here are your commands and stats for battle:
Attack: Does damage
Defend: Defends against damage.
Use Item: Uses an item in your inventory*
Special move: Uses a special attack that can only be done once every ten turns.
Run: Runs from combat, and instantly loses. The one who didn't run wins.
Rolling:
Attack:
1. miss
2. 5 damage
3. 10 damage
4. miss
5. 15 damage
6. 20 damage.
Defend:
1. doesn't protect
2. 2 health protected
3. 4 health protected
4. doesn't protect
5. 7 health protected
6. attacker misses
Item:
Just say what item you use. Can only use one item per turn.
Special move:
1. use special
2. don't use special
3. don't use special
4. use special
5. don't use special
6. use special
Run:
1. don't run
2. run
3. don't run
4. run
5. don't run
6. run
Every person has 200 health, and start out with two health potions.
